#dd8c39 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dd8c39 is composed of 86.7% red, 54.9%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.7% magenta, 74.2%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 30.4 degrees, a saturation of 70.7% and a lightness of 54.5%. #dd8c39 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ff72 with #bb1900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#dd8c39 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dd8c39 has RGB values of R:221, G:140,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.74,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14519353.

Shades and Tints of #dd8c39

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030200 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dd8c39

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8b89 is the less saturated color, while #f88c1e is the most saturated one.
